Problem
Traditional electric nail files are limited by stationary control boxes with cords, restricting portability, and existing portable systems have battery life constraints, necessitating improved power management and charging solutions.
Innovation Solution
A portable electric nail filing system with a control box and charging base featuring rechargeable batteries and power controllers, allowing for flexible charging and operation modes, including simultaneous battery charging and use, and interchangeable covers for aesthetic customization.

The disclosure relates to a portable electric nail filing system, the system including a control box for supplying power and control to an electric nail file handpiece, the control box including a rechargeable battery and a processor. Also, a charging base is provided for engaging the control box, the charging base operable to recharge the rechargeable battery of the control box while the control box is engaged with the charging base, the charging base also including a rechargeable battery to be charged from an external source such as an AC outlet.
